Apexes[edit]

The apex of human psychic evolution. The apexes are terrible creatures to behold.

An apex focusing it psychic power into a deadly attack!

Personality[edit]

Apexes are quite similar to humans when it come to personality, however many apexes suffer from some form of insanity. Apexes are often "control freaks" thanks to their incredible intelligence and powerful personality. Apexes are often seen as manipulators and schemers, some cultures however see them as powerful leaders and sages.

Physical Description[edit]

Apexes does not deviate too much from humanity when it come to appearance. Among the few differences, apexes tend to have a lighter tone of skin. Powerful apexes often have grey skin as their powerful psychic aura slowly decays it. All apexes have pupil-less silver eyes. Apexes tend to be taller and slimmer than regular humans.

Relations[edit]

Apexes are a mutation of humans instead of a race of their own. Other races tend to see them as haughty and very creepy humans at best and madmen and a direct threat at worst.

Alignment[edit]

Apexes, like humans, do not gravitate toward particular alignments.

Lands[edit]

Apexes live on land alongside humans, often managing to place themselves at the top of the food chain. Usually ending as nobles or powerful merchants, having a great deal of influence over human policy.

Religion[edit]

Apexes are known to have very diverse religious beliefs, like their genetic fathers, humans.

Language[edit]

Apexes use telepathy to communicate beyond the borders of language. They still share a native language with humans (such as Common).

Names[edit]

Apexes are named with human names. Their names depend greatly on the human culture they were born in.

Vital Statistics[edit]

Table: Apex Random Starting Ages
Adulthood Simple Moderate Complex
15 years +1d4 +1d6 +2d6
Table: Apex Aging Effects
Middle Age1 Old2 Venerable3 Maximum Age
135 years 253 years 470 years +3d100 years
  1. At middle age, −1 to Str, Dex, and Con; +1 to Int, Wis, and Cha.
  2. At old age, −2 to Str, Dex, and Con; +1 to Int, Wis, and Cha.
  3. At venerable age, −3 to Str, Dex, and Con; +1 to Int, Wis, and Cha.
Table: Apex Random Height and Weight
Gender Base Height Height Modifier Base Weight Weight Modifier
Male 4’ 10” +2d10 120 lb. × (2d4) lb.
Female 4’ 5” +2d10 85 lb. × (2d4) lb.
